Founded in London in 1912, Biffa is a leading UK nationwide integrated waste management business providing collection, treatment, recycling and technologically-driven energy generation services. Through the expertise of our people and investment in technology we promote and deliver sustainable waste management solutions. We provide an essential service to satisfy the business needs of our commercial, industrial and public sector customers throughout the UK, and help them to meet their legal obligations and corporate responsibility commitments. We employ 10,000 people and collect waste from thousands of businesses and millions of households across the UK each day.  Our surplus food redistribution partnership with Company Shop Group, and our environmental work with BiffaAward and Waste Aid, also have wider benefits for the UK and beyond. Since 2002 we’ve reduced our carbon emissions by 70 per cent and aim to be net zero by 2050.
